Tom Harper is a renowned author who writes under the pen name of Edwin Thomas. He is known for his expertise in historical fiction and thriller novels. Harper was born in Frankfurt, West Germany, and spent his formative years in Belgium and Connecticut. His love for history led him to study the subject at Lincoln College Oxford. After working for a few years, he decided to pursue his passion for writing and entered the CWA Debut Dagger contest, where he was recognized as a runner-up.
Harper's writing career took off in 2003 with the publication of his debut novel, "The Blighted Cliffs," which he wrote under his original name, Edwin Thomas. His first novel under the pseudonym, "The Mosaic of Shadows," was published in 2004. Since then, he has written eleven historical thriller novels, all of which have been translated into twenty foreign languages worldwide. He is the author of the Martin Jerrold and Demetrios Askiates series, as well as several standalone novels.
Harper currently resides in York, England, with his wife and two sons. He is an active member of the Crime Writers' Association, the Historical Novels Society, and the Society of Authors. In addition to writing under the name Tom Harper, he also writes historical adventures as Edwin Thomas. Despite having multiple names, Harper has established himself as a successful author in the world of historical fiction and thrillers.
